Font Size: a A A

Design And Implementation Of Multimedia Communication System Based On Sip Protocol

Posted on:2020-07-22Degree:MasterType:Thesis
Country:ChinaCandidate:Z L RenFull Text:PDF
GTID:2428330572973638Subject:Computer Science and Technology
Abstract/Summary:PDF Full Text Request
With the rapid development of mobile Internet,the traditional and single form of communication has been unable to satisfy people's needs.A functional multimedia communication platform with compatibility is gradually becoming a stronger demand.At the same time,devices based on SIP are widely used,and the communication industry will continue to apply more SIP devices to the living and production environment in the future.Therefore,the realization of platform,which can allow various types of terminals to access and provide rich communication services,can not only improve the utilization of existing SIP devices,but also integrate current popular web tenninals.Moreover,it can be applied to many kinds of scenarios.The communication system proposed in this paper is based on SIP protocol and adopts centralized media control scheme,which can maximize the compatibility of terminals and provide rich communication services.During the design and implementation of communication system,multimedia application server is the important network entity.And it can support multi-node deployment and cross-node communication,which further improves the expanding and carrying capacity of communication system.During the process of design,we propose a unified communication strategy based on priority queue.And we also propose a system request control scheme combining token bucket algorithm and recurrent neural network algorithm,which can guarantee the stability and reliability of the system.Following the basic steps of software engineering,we describe the specific situation in the process of developing the subject step by step.Firstly,the requirement analysis is carried out according to the specific application scenarios of the system,and the three business types of point-to-point communication,conference communication and instant messaging and their specific functions are described.Secondly,the architecture of the system is designed,and the selections of key solutions are studied such as terminal compatibility and media control.Then,the core entity is designed based on modularization,including user and authentication module,communication module,monitoring module and management module.And we use state mode during the design of signaling interaction and state maintenance schemes for different functional items in communication module.Based on the above analysis,the implementation details of the communication system,such as the application of middleware,the design of data structure and multi-threading technology,are introduced.Finally,we design test cases for functional and performance testing.And the results show that the communication system studied,designed and implemented in this paper can satisfy the expected requirements and is of good feasibility.
Keywords/Search Tags:Multimedia communication, SIP, Centralized control, Cross-node communication, Strategy design
PDF Full Text Request
Related items